Rough Copy magazine, online magazine for creative writing, short stories and artistic expression, is soliciting poetry submissions for its Fall 2009 and Spring 2010 issues.
Visit their submissions page to see where to send your work. We heard that all submissions will receive a reply within two weeks, and that simultaneous and previous submissions are okay. How much do we love that?! Go forth and submit.

Robert Frost Foundation 2009 poetry contest:
Annual Poetry Award for poems written in the "spirit of Robert Frost."
- Website: http://frostfoundation.home.comcast.net/~frostfoundation/wsb/html/frostsite1215/home.htm
- Deadline: Poems should be postmarked (or emailed) between March 1,
2009 and September 15, 2009 to be considered for the 2009 award. - Reading Fee: $10.00 per poem
- Award: Unclear
Visit the website and click on 'Poetry Award' for more information on
submission guidelines.

Call for Poems: Anon Poetry
A poetry magazine which uses a blind review system to select its works is calling for submissions.
Anon is a "print-based poetry magazine where poems are assessed anonymously." After a submission is accepted, then they publish the poet's name. They are now accepting submissions for their next magazine. They are looking for thoughtful and interesting poetry no longer than 40-50 lines.
Please go to http://www.anonpoetry.co.uk/submissions for more information. Follow the submission instructions carefully as any attempt to include your name on your submissions will result in disqualification. If your work is published, your name will be listed with the poem.
If you want to be considered, you should submit soon.

Check out the Poets & Writers Database of Small Presses and Publishers
Poets & Writers has a small but growing database of small presses and publishers that would come in handy for any writer looking to submit work for publication.
Find out whether they take online submissions, simultaneous submissions, the genre they publish and their reading periods.

Screamfest Screenwriting Contest - Early Deadline June 15
9th Annual Screamfest Horror Film Festival & Screenplay Competition announces its call for entries.
Prizes include cash, software and an amazing trophy.
Genre(s) : Horror / Thriller
Deadlines and submission fees:
- (Early) June 15th $30
- (Regular) July 15th $50
- (FINAL) Aug. 15th $60
